What companies run services between Varsity Lakes, QLD, Australia and Robina Stadium, QLD, Australia?

Translink operates a train from Varsity Lakes station, platform 2 to Robina station, platform 2 every 20 minutes. Tickets cost $1 and the journey takes 3 min. Alternatively, Translink operates a bus from Varsity Pde at Lakefront Crescent to Robina station every 15 minutes. Tickets cost $1 and the journey takes 10 min.
